Market Size and Overview

The Global Medical Equipment Maintenance Market size is estimated to be valued at USD 55.72 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 106.60 billion by 2033,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.7% from 2026 to 2033.

Medical Equipment Maintenance Market Growth is driven by expanding healthcare services, regulatory compliances for equipment upkeep, and rising industry demand for preventive maintenance to reduce operational downtime. The medical equipment maintenance market report underscores increased investments in infrastructure upgrades and growing adoption of Internet of Medical Things (IoMT) technologies as key components influencing market size and revenue.

Market Drivers
- Rising Demand for Preventive Maintenance and Equipment Reliability:
The growing focus on minimizing unplanned medical equipment failures is a critical driver shaping the market growth. For example, hospitals in the U.S. reported a 15% reduction in equipment downtime in 2024 by adopting predictive maintenance services powered by AI analytics. This push towards proactive maintenance optimizes equipment lifecycle and enhances healthcare delivery, thus expanding market opportunities for providers specializing in maintenance solutions, reflecting positively on the industry size and market revenue.

PEST Analysis

- Political:
Increasing government regulations worldwide in 2024, particularly in North America and Europe, mandate regular certification and maintenance of critical medical equipment, driving demand and investment in maintenance services. Compliance policies enhance market dynamics by increasing service adoption rates.

- Economic:
Despite global inflationary pressures in 2024, healthcare sector investments remain resilient, with many emerging economies allocating higher budgets to healthcare infrastructure upgrades, thus broadening the market scope and accelerating business growth for maintenance players.

- Social:
Growing patient awareness and emphasis on quality care in 2025 have led healthcare providers to prioritize medical equipment functionality. This social trend supports increased maintenance contracts and contributes directly to medical equipment maintenance market trends.

- Technological:
Technological breakthroughs such as IoT-enabled remote monitoring and AI-based predictive maintenance introduced in 2025 are revolutionizing service delivery, reducing costs, and preventing equipment failures—thereby creating new market growth strategies and enhancing market insights on future revenue streams.

Key Players
- Koninklijke Philips N.V.
- Medtronic
- GE Healthcare
- B. Braun Melsungen AG
- Althea Group
- Siemens Healthineers
- Agiliti
- Sodexo Healthcare

Recent strategies in 2024-25 include:
- Koninklijke Philips N.V.: Expanded its service network in Asia-Pacific, resulting in a 20% uplift in regional business growth.
- GE Healthcare: Launched AI-enabled predictive maintenance platforms improving service efficiency by 18%.
- Siemens Healthineers: Formed partnerships with healthcare providers in Europe to offer integrated maintenance and asset management solutions, boosting market share.
- Althea Group: Acquired smaller regional players in 2025, enhancing its global footprint and revenue streams.

These developments reflect overarching market trends and reveal strategic moves influencing market revenue and the competitive landscape in the medical equipment maintenance market.
